Verra Mobility Expands Automated Tolling for Italian Rental Cars

Verra Mobility Corporation, a prominent provider of smart mobility technology solutions, has extended its electronic toll payment programmes to include more rental car locations across Italy. This expansion aims to simplify toll payments for tourists and locals alike, offering its automated tolling service in collaboration with two of Europe’s largest rental car companies.

This service, initially launched earlier this year, now covers over 25% of the Italian rental car market, which operates an estimated fleet of 50,000 vehicles. Italy, home to one of the largest toll road networks in Europe, has over 4,600 kilometres of tolled motorways. The country’s appeal as a top tourist destination, with over 134 million visitors annually, often leads to increased demand for rental vehicles during peak season. An average of 137,000 rental cars, with numbers peaking at 164,000, use these tolled roads each year.

Verra Mobility’s solution allows renters to use an installed electronic toll device connected to their rental agreement. The device ensures seamless toll payment, with users paying a flat daily fee covering all tolls. Through its strategic partnership with Telepass, a leader in integrated mobility, the programme grants access to 100% of Italy’s toll network, enabling users to bypass manual toll booths and use fast lanes.

Tsjerk-Friso Roelfzema, Senior Vice President and General Manager for Verra Mobility in Europe, explained the benefits: “Paying tolls manually when renting a car can be a hassle, often leading to delays and congestion. The scale of Italy’s motorway network and the large influx of tourists make efficient tolling systems essential. Our partnership with these rental car companies has been instrumental in introducing this streamlined service for both tourists and locals.”

Telepass Chief Business Sales Officer Paolo Malerba highlighted the value of the collaboration, saying, “Telepass is committed to making car travel easier and more efficient across Italy. Verra Mobility is the perfect partner to help us achieve this, and together we are simplifying travel both in Italy and beyond.”

The service’s expansion is a direct result of Verra Mobility’s partnership with Telepass, which was announced in 2023. Telepass, an Italian-based mobility specialist, enables Verra Mobility to extend its tolling solution across Italy. In addition to Italy, Verra Mobility currently operates tolling programmes in Ireland and Spain, with plans to expand the service into Portugal and France.

Verra Mobility has been providing toll management solutions for fleet owners and rental companies for over 15 years. Its toll management services process more than 300 million toll and violation transactions annually, serving more than seven million vehicles worldwide. The company’s technology matches toll charges to specific vehicles and drivers, ensuring that costs are accurately billed and collected, saving both time and administrative effort.

This move by Verra Mobility is expected to enhance the driving experience for both tourists and local drivers in Italy, simplifying the process of toll payments and reducing congestion on the country’s busy motorways.
